America, the Los Angeles Kings did you a solid for Memorial Day weekend. The Kings invited Slash to Game 3 of the Western Conference finals on Saturday night at Staples Center. Joined by a sergeant Corey Lamel of the U.S. Marine Corps, the former Guns 'N' Roses guitarist took the ice and delivered a rendition of "The Star-Spangled Banner" before the home team faced the Chicago Blackhawks.
